Macquarie 'Save Dave' Decision In Tune With Public's View

Macquarie's David Kiely, the client investment manager who was seen on live TV opening up photos on his work PC monitor of a scantily-dressed Miranda Kerr, the Australian supermodel, is to keep his job.

The decision to keep Kiely on the payroll will be generally applauded by the public, as it is in tune with their views on the matter.

We asked our readers what they thought Macquarie should do about Dave, and here's the result of our poll. Over 3,650 people took part.

Only 4.1% of respondents said that they thought Dave should have got fired

22.9% said that he should be bought a drink because of all the stick he was getting

28.7% said that he should be patted on the back as he has single-handedly put Macquarie Bank on the map.

44.3% said that he should get a gentle slap on the wrist, but keep his job.
